#ffcfdc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ffcfdc is composed of 100% red, 81.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 343.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 90.6%. #ffcfdc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ff9fb9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#ffcfdc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0003 is the darkest color, while #fff6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ffcfdc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e9e5e6 is the less saturated color, while #ffcfdc is the most saturated one.
